Availability Details
Whilst our 6 week induction will all be on a Thursday 10am - 12noon, after that, we are flexible on when a volunteer attends the office and can discuss this with individuals. A commitment to attend ALL induction training sessions will be a prerequisite. Alongside the induction training, volunteers will have the opportunity to commence shadowing an adviser for one session a week. This is optional, but would be helpful to assist learning. Further training will be scheduled as deemed appropriate. The training will be delivered in person, at CLS Northampton office in Hazelwood Road NN1 1LG. Induction Training schedule: Session 1 – Thursday 7th May 10am – 12 noon Introduction to CLS Session 2 – Thursday 14th May 10am – 12 noon Welfare Benefits overview Session 3 – Thursday 21st May 10am – 12 noon Introduction to Personal Independence Payment Session 4 - Thursday 28th May 10am – 12 noon Introduction to Universal Credit Session 5 – Thursday 4th June 10am – 12 noon Introduction to Debt Session 6 – Thursday 11th June 10am – 12 noon Advice Pro – Case Management System
